Shipping containers that have double doors at both ends, rather than just one, are called tunnel containers. They can be purchased as new 'one-trip' containers or as a converted second-hand storage containers.
They are ideal to store equipment and goods as the dual access points allow items to be easily removed from either side without having to move them around. Tunnel containers can also be partitioned across the middle to create two secure storage units in the event of need.

A tunnel shipping container has two entry points, making it simple to break it in half and create two separate units. This is usually used for creating offices on site or storage. Many containerised self storage yards have a number of tunnel containers they simply partition across the middle to create smaller storage spaces for their clients.

Storage is easy with tunnel containers, also called double door shipping containers. With double doors at both ends, they provide easy access to the sides of the container without the need to move things around to gain access. This is especially useful for storing bulky or heavy items such as furniture. Many self storage businesses use these types of containers as they are able to divide them into smaller storage units by constructing a partition wall that allows them to create two separate storage containers of 10 feet at the same cost as one 20ft tunnel container.
Shipping tunnels for containers are offered in both new 'one trip condition and in used containers that have been refurbished. They are typically constructed from a standard container, with the solid part removed and two doors that are welded to each end (as as opposed to a single-ended end).
